Radial drift speed comparision between the approximate Eq. (8) and the numerical solution to the differential equations. The radius is 1 m, the initial location is at 2 AU, temperature and midplane density are constant over the disk and set to 140 K and 2.5 × 1010 g cm−3. Initially thebody moves with Keplerian speed in azimuthal direction and no radial velocity. The dashed, vertical line marks the stopping time.
